Meet the Maker: Anna von Lipa and the Art of Bohemian Glass

Anna von Lipa collaborates with master glassblowers in the historic glassmaking region of Bohemia to create contemporary pieces with an heirloom feel. The signature hobnail texture—those jewel-like studs you see on many of their designs—plays with sunlight, diffusing it across the table in prismatic patterns. The result is glassware with remarkable clarity and tactility, a balance of old-world technique and modern color stories.

Because each piece is mouth-blown and finished by hand, slight variations in pattern, thickness, and hue are expected and welcomed. These nuances are more than details; they’re the maker’s mark, the visible personality of a process that values human touch over mass production. Care & craft notes: As with any handblown glass, gentle handling is key. Wash with warm, soapy water and a soft sponge; avoid abrupt temperature changes. Because each piece is made by hand, slight differences in color or pattern are part of its character. These variations are intentional—they’re what distinguish artisan glass from the uniformity of mass production.
